draw a perpendicular line from the directrix passing through the focus, this will be the line of symmetry.
The vertex(h, k) will be located on the line half way between the focus and directrix.
The distance from the focus to the vertex is called the focal length, call it a. The then equation is
(x - h)^2 = 4a(y - k)
the equation can be manipulated to
y = 1/4a(x - h)^2 + k
